GOING GULFSTREAM – DEC 2

Wish we had the nerve to go against this favorite but the way Mike Maker’s going at this meet it’s hard to pull the trigger against early line favorite Bramble Boy (5-2).

But he’s figures have improved two straight on the Thoro-Graph scale since the three-back claim, makes his second start at this claiming level after exiting his Aqueduct finale in which he earned a layover figure.

When the Maker horses do that, they generally hold their form over a sustained period. The mini-turn back should only accentuate his punch and his tactical speed should not give him too much to do. And did we mention that ‘Bramble’ is 1-for-1 in Hallandale?

But there are others who interest, two price shots, who we would use in various, sundry way. Ha’ Penny (30-1) is making his turf debut with a proper pedigree and he is forward looking. He’s been keeping good company.

Then there’s Frippet (15-1) who is placed properly at this level but compromised by a wide draw; perhaps Paco can do something about that. Further, Kahiko (3-1) absolutely loves this course and distance. He, too, is drawn outside but attracts Miguel Vasquez, having a career year.

We’re going to take Bramble Boy to win with no price restrictions, key him on top of the three above in the trifecta, and will key-box exactas with the same three, looking for a price shot on top.
